#74e485 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#74e485 is composed of 45.5% red, 89.4% green and 52.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 41.7%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 129.1 degrees, a saturation of 67.5% and a lightness of 67.5%. #74e485 color hex could be obtained by blending #e8ffff with #00c90b.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

● #74e485 color description : Soft lime green.
The hexadecimal color #74e485 has RGB values of R:116, G:228, B:133 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0, Y:0.42,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 7660677.
